Pumpkin pancake

These pumpkin pancakes and chocolate chips are so soft and incredibly easy to prepare, whether with box or homemade pumpkin puree. They are ready in 30 minutes with only 10 minutes of preparation!
Servings 4 people
Preparation time 20 minutes
Cooking time for 10 minutes

Ingredients

  • 250 g of all use flour
  • 100 gr of sugar or less
  • 1 teaspoon of salt
  • 1 tablespoon of cinnamon powder
  • 2 teaspoon of baking powder
  • 2 teaspoon of baking soda
  • 200 g pumpkin puree I used homemade puree
  • 300 ml of milk
  • 2 big eggs
  • 30 g of melted butter about 2 tablespoons
  • 2 Vanilla extract teaspoons
  • 130 g of semi-succre chocolate chocolate

Instructions

  • Mix the dry ingredients: in a large bowl, whisk the flour, sugar, salt, baking powder, baking soda and cinnamon powder.

  • Mix the wet ingredients: in a small bowl, whisk the pumpkin puree, milk, eggs, melted butter and vanilla extract.

  • Combine the wet and dry ingredients: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and whip until a homogeneous paste. Stop whipping as soon as all the ingredients are well incorporated and there is no more visible flour.

  • Add the chocolate chips: gently incorporate the chocolate chips into the dough.
  • Cook the pancakes: place a pan or large baking sheet over medium heat. Add a tablespoon of butter to the pan. When the butter foam disappears, pour the dough into the pan to form 1 pancake.
  • Cook the pancakes on one side for 3-4 minutes until bubbles are formed on top, then turn them over and cook the other side still 3-4 minutes, until they are completely cooked.
